§ 8107-5.6.14. Exceptions to noise standard.  


Latest version.
  • The noise standard established pursuant to Sec. 8107-5.6.13 shall not be exceeded unless covered under any of the following provisions:

    a.

    Where the ambient noise levels (excluding the subject facility) exceed the applicable noise standards. In such cases, the maximum allowable noise levels shall not exceed the ambient noise levels plus 3 dB(A).

    b.

    Where the owners/occupants of sensitive uses have signed a waiver pursuant to Sec. 8107-5.6.25 indicating that they are aware that drilling and production operations could exceed the allowable noise standard and that they are willing to experience such noise levels. The applicable noise levels shall apply at all locations where the owners/occupants did not sign such a waiver.
